However, a systematic review and meta-analysis are needed to summarize the evidence and guide clinical recommendations. The objective of this study was to evaluate, through a systematic review and meta-analysis, whether inoffice irradiation of carbamide peroxide with violet light can improve the effect of tooth whitening without increasing sensitivity. Methodology: The searches for studies were conducted in the databases PubMed, Embase, Scopus, Web of Science and Google Scholar. Two independent and calibrated examiners (Kappa: 0.88) performed all systematic steps according to the PRISMA protocol. To assess the risk of bias, the RoB 2 tool was used. GRADE was used to analyze the certainty of evidence. Meta-analysis was performed using RevMan 5.4 software to evaluate tooth color change and tooth sensitivity to bleaching. The former was assessed by mean difference and the latter by risk difference. Results: Three randomized clinical trials were included. A statistically significant difference was found for color change favoring the application of violet light combined with carbamide peroxide (MD, 3.35; 95% CI, 0.80, 5.89), while no difference between groups was found for tooth sensitivity to bleaching (RD, 0.09; 95% CI, -0.03, 0.21). Conclusion: Violet light irradiation enhanced the in-office bleaching effect of carbamide peroxide without increasing sensitivity. However, the results regarding bleaching sensitivity should be interpreted with caution due to the moderate certainty of the evidence.","abstract_html":"Introduction: Violet light irradiation has been proposed to enhance the in-office bleaching effect of carbamide peroxide.
